Opportunity Information: Apply for PAR 18 669

This funding opportunity, titled "Limited Competition: Specific Pathogen Free Macaque Colonies (U42 Clinical Trial Not Allowed)" (PAR 18 669), is a National Institutes of Health (NIH) discretionary grant program offered as a cooperative agreement under the health funding activity category (CFDA 93.351). Its main goal is to provide continued support for established specific pathogen free (SPF) macaque breeding colonies that were previously supported through the earlier announcement PAR-14-066. In practical terms, this is not a new open competition to build colonies from scratch; it is designed to maintain and sustain colonies that already exist within the defined NIH-supported framework.

The scientific purpose behind the program is tightly tied to HIV/AIDS research needs. Macaques are a critical animal model for studying HIV pathogenesis, immune responses, prevention strategies, and treatment approaches, and maintaining reliable breeding colonies is essential to keep that research moving. The emphasis on "specific pathogen free" animals reflects a major quality and safety requirement: these macaques are screened and maintained to be free of certain viruses that could either skew (confound) HIV/AIDS-related experimental outcomes or pose occupational health risks to the veterinarians, animal care staff, and researchers who work with them. By reducing background infections and unknown variables, SPF colonies help ensure that research findings are interpretable and reproducible across studies and institutions.

A second key feature of the colonies supported under this opportunity is genetic characterization, specifically for major histocompatibility complex (MHC) class I types. MHC class I variation strongly influences immune recognition and antiviral responses, which is a central issue in HIV/AIDS research where host genetics can shape disease course and vaccine or therapeutic outcomes. Having pedigreed macaques with known MHC class I profiles allows investigators to design better-controlled studies, interpret immune response data more accurately, and compare results across experiments where genetic background might otherwise be a hidden source of variability.

From an administrative standpoint, the mechanism is a U42 cooperative agreement, which generally means NIH expects substantial involvement in the funded activity compared with a standard research grant. The announcement explicitly states "Clinical Trial Not Allowed," signaling that the award is intended to support colony operations and related resource activities rather than clinical trial work. The original closing date listed for the opportunity was January 7, 2021, and the opportunity was created on February 21, 2018.

Eligibility is limited and notably excludes foreign participation. Public and state-controlled institutions of higher education are listed as eligible applicants, and the announcement makes clear that non-U.S. entities (foreign institutions) cannot apply. It also bars non-domestic components of U.S. organizations, and it does not allow foreign components as defined by the NIH Grants Policy Statement. In other words, the supported colony activities must be fully domestic with no foreign components embedded in the proposed work. The announcement also references the FOA for full eligibility details, which is important because limited-competition announcements often include additional restrictions, such as prior funding history or specific colony qualification requirements tied to the earlier PAR-14-066 program.

Overall, the opportunity is best understood as NIH maintaining a specialized national research resource: well-characterized, pedigreed SPF macaque colonies that are essential infrastructure for HIV/AIDS research. The intent is to protect the integrity of AIDS-related studies, reduce biosafety and occupational risks, and ensure the continued availability of animals with defined health and immunogenetic status for the research community.
